自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

-流星雨-的专栏

翱翔在电脑知识的海洋

  • 博客(5)
  • 资源 (4)
  • 收藏
  • 关注

转载 #define #ifdef #endif

<br />http://hi.baidu.com/taney/blog/item/1a06abee1763d92a2df534b7.html最近在用C语写一些程序,发现#ifdef,#else,#endif和#ifndef,#else,#endif在UCOS-II中有大量的应用,于是到网上查了一些相关的解释.#ifdef的用法<br />灵活使用#ifdef指示符,我们可以区隔一些与特定头文件、程序库和其他文件版本有关的代码。<br />代码举例:新建define.cpp文件#include "iostr

2010-12-11 23:16:00 457

原创 typedef和define具体的详细区别

<br />1) #define是预处理指令,在编译预处理时进行简单的替换,不作正确性检查,不关含义是否正确照样带入,只有在编译已被展开的源程序时才会发现可能的错误并报错。例如:<br />#define PI 3.1415926<br />程序中的:area=PI*r*r 会替换为3.1415926*r*r<br />如果你把#define语句中的数字9 写成字母g 预处理也照样带入。<br /><br />2)typedef是在编译时处理的。它在自己的作用域内给一个已经存在的类型一个别名,但是You c

2010-12-03 19:37:00 407

转载 snull是作什么用的?

<br />实际上ldd上说的太复杂 ,不太让人好懂,就是ldd的作者为了让俺们调试方便,让我们能够在一台机器上进行调试人为地搞了那么多乱七八糟的东西,snull发出的包在发出前目的地址被修改了 ,就这么点事情 ,比如我们ping 192.168.0.123 ,硬件收到包后调用snull的包处理部分,这个部分先把收到的包的目的地址改为192.168.1.123 ,然后再把这个包丢给应用程序 ,于是一句话 ,俺原来ping 192.168.0.123发出的icmp包变成了ping 192.168.1.123产

2010-12-03 18:33:00 2170

原创 360是如何盈利的(整理)

1、现在主要是风险投资支持着,另一个主要的收入来源是推销杀毒软件,比如当年卡巴斯基就是靠360给推广开来的,听说360每为卡巴斯基带来一个用户就能从卡巴斯基那里得到0.5元,目前360上的广告很少,从他们的软件上就能看出来.将来就不好说了,一旦有一个庞大的用户基数,什么事情都会做出来的,现在不是连千千静听都弹出前程无忧广告了,本来一生气想不用千千静听,后来还是没舍得,用这么多年了,自己把广告删了也就是了.2、360杀毒盈利至少有以下资本和途径:(1) 庞大的用户群。360杀毒的免费自然会带来庞大的用户群,这

2010-12-02 21:59:00 40549

原创 希望这篇文章改变了你

<br /> 哈佛有一个著名的理论:人的差别在于业余时间,而一个人的命运决定于晚上8点到10点之间。每晚抽出2个小时的时间用来阅读、进修、思考或参加有意的演讲、讨论,你会发现,你的人生正在发生改变,坚持数年之后,成功会向你招手。<br />    无论你的收入是多少,记得分成五份进行规划投资:增加对身体的投资,让身体始终好用;增加对社交的投资,扩大你的人脉;增加对学习的投资,加强你的自信;增加对旅游的投资,扩大你的见闻;增加对未来的投资,增加你的收益。好好规划落实,你会发现你的人生逐步会有大量盈余。<br

2010-12-01 19:53:00 902 1

基于协议分析的网络监测系统研究与实现(论文)

网络抓包和分析技术是很多网络安全软件实现的基础,也是设计网络分析软件的基础,现有的一些技术如防火墙、协议分析等软件的实现都是以数据包的嗅探捕获为前提的,所以研究相关的数据包捕获和分析技术对保证网络的安全运行是很有现实意义的。 本文对Windows下基于WinPcap的网络监测与协议分析技术进行了深入的研究,详细的研究了WinPcap的框架,得出了基于WinPcap驱动开发的一般过程,最后实现了一个数据包捕获解析器CapturePacket。程序中网络监听的目标是TCP/IP协议中的ARP、IP、TCP、UDP甲种协议,以Windows XP操作系统为平台,在Visual C++环境下使用WinPcap驱动从TCP/IP协议栈的数据链路层捕获原始数据包,并从中提取出以上四种协议及数据包的数据。 通过在实际环境中测试,证明了本系统可以比较高效地监听到和所设定的过滤条件一致的数据包,并显示每个包的协议、源IP地址、目的IP地址、数据包长和包内的数据等内容,可以帮助网络管理员分析网络数据,具有一定的实用价值,主要表现在以下几个方面:(1)首先实现了对本机上所有网卡的自由选择。(2)实现了自定义包过滤规则,可以同时绑定主机、协议和端口,能有针对性地监听某些类型的数据包,并且能以协议树的形式显示协议的层次。(3)以太网链路层帧的截获和分析,并实现对ARP、IP、TCP、UDP四种协议的支持。(4)实现对捕获数据的十六进制及ASCII码显示。 关键词:数据包捕获;WinPcap;协议分析;TCP/IP协议; VC++6.0

2012-06-06

WEB编程技术课件之导航控件

WEB编程技术课件中详细讲解了关于导航控件的制作方法,其中包含了课件与C#源码,适合于初学者的学习与参考~~~

2010-05-30

用C#语言编写的具有登录功能的通讯录源程序

该通讯录是用C#编写的具有登录、注销、记住密码、找回密码、密码保护、按类别查询、按姓名模糊查询以及常规的通讯录功能(用listview显示,添加、修改、删除、查询)的应用软件。 研究完该程序后你可以了解完整的项目开发步骤及源程序所有的文件。该程序虽小,可是五脏俱全!

2010-05-06

用C#语言编写的具有登录功能的通讯录

该通讯录是用C#编写的具有登录、注销、记住密码、找回密码、密码保护、按类别查询、按姓名模糊查询以及常规的通讯录功能的应用软件。该程序虽小可谓五脏俱全,欢迎大家下载

2010-05-06

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除